
Shakira looks sweet on the outside, but she has a snarky side ready to come out at the right moment -- like her first appearance as a judge in the fourth season of "The Voice."
The Colombian superstar started with a bang in her new role as coach. Shakira joked about the other judges -- Adam Levine and Blake Shelton -- saying they are "deaf after three seasons" and cannot properly assess contestants. She even mocked fellow newcomer Usher's relaxed attitude, mimicking his posture by putting her foot up.
Her charm and approachable personality did shine through when she addressed the singers though -- she earnestly praised one contestant to tears.
"You can take the world by storm," she enthusiastically told the elated singer.
Shakira also became personal with another one by talking to their native Spanish and jumping to the stage to hug her.
Her fellow judges were stunned by the Colombian's zing.
"Shakira is so sweet and beautiful," said "The Voice" veteran Blake Shelton. "And then ... the claws come out."
"She spits out razors," added Usher.

This year is proving to be a busy one for Shakira. She joined "The Voice" a mere month after giving birth to baby boy Milan, which she had with her boyfriend, Spanish soccer player Gerard Piqué. The singer is also a very active humanitarian and philanthropist. Two years ago, President Obama named her President's Advisory Commission on Educational Excellence for Hispanics, and she recently conducted a World Baby Shower sponsored by UNICEF that collected over 80,000 vaccinations against polio.
